Variable: speedbar-buffer-easymenu-definition
speedbar-buffer-easymenu-definition is a variable defined in
speedbar.el.gz.
Value
(["Jump to buffer" speedbar-edit-line t]
["Expand File Tags" speedbar-expand-line
(save-excursion (beginning-of-line) (looking-at "[0-9]+: *.\\+. "))]
["Flush Cache & Expand" speedbar-flush-expand-line
(save-excursion (beginning-of-line) (looking-at "[0-9]+: *.\\+. "))]
["Contract File Tags" speedbar-contract-line
(save-excursion (beginning-of-line) (looking-at "[0-9]+: *.-. "))]
"----"
["Kill Buffer" speedbar-buffer-kill-buffer
(save-excursion
(beginning-of-line) (looking-at "[0-9]+: *.[-+?]. "))]
["Revert Buffer" speedbar-buffer-revert-buffer
(save-excursion
(beginning-of-line) (looking-at "[0-9]+: *.[-+?]. "))])
Documentation
Menu item elements shown when displaying a buffer list.
Source Code
;; Defined in /usr/src/emacs/lisp/speedbar.el.gz
(defvar speedbar-buffer-easymenu-definition
'(["Jump to buffer" speedbar-edit-line t]
["Expand File Tags" speedbar-expand-line
(save-excursion (beginning-of-line)
(looking-at "[0-9]+: *.\\+. "))]
["Flush Cache & Expand" speedbar-flush-expand-line
(save-excursion (beginning-of-line)
(looking-at "[0-9]+: *.\\+. "))]
["Contract File Tags" speedbar-contract-line
(save-excursion (beginning-of-line)
(looking-at "[0-9]+: *.-. "))]
"----"
["Kill Buffer" speedbar-buffer-kill-buffer
(save-excursion (beginning-of-line)
(looking-at "[0-9]+: *.[-+?]. "))]
["Revert Buffer" speedbar-buffer-revert-buffer
(save-excursion (beginning-of-line)
(looking-at "[0-9]+: *.[-+?]. "))]
)
"Menu item elements shown when displaying a buffer list.")